So I’m thinking of trying something a little different fo me with the rock-work. Use live base rock for the biologicals then some dry rock like Marco rock for creating structure and then top it off with some primo live rock for diversity and possible critters. Thoughts?
 
You just going to stack everything or glue it together? Live rock is never a bad idea.
 
You just going to stack everything or glue it together? Live rock is never a bad idea.
Well my thought was 10-15 lbs base, just enough dry to make some arches and such and another 10-15 primo. I’d glue the dry int some shapes and then stack the rest. That way I could have premade architecture to work around
 
Sounds like a good plan. Make sure the top stuff sits good and level on the shapes you make for stability. I've had rocks fall in larger tanks when snails and hermits get ambitious.
